#750a4a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#750a4a is composed of 45.9% red, 3.9%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.5%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 324.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 24.9%. #750a4a color hex could be obtained by blending #ea1494 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#750a4a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#750a4a has RGB values of R:117, G:10,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.37,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7670346.

Shades and Tints of #750a4a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090105 is the darkest color, while #fef6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#750a4a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#443b40 is the less saturated color, while #7f004c is the most saturated one.
